The Buffalo Prenatal-Perinatal Network was
incorporated in 1987, as a not-for-profit organization, to help
improve the health of women and babies in the Buffalo regional
area. The Network identifies problems of adequacy, acceptability,
and accessibility in the delivery of health and human services;
initiates demonstration projects to address such problems; encourages
and seeks support for implementation of programs which have a
positive impact on the community and especially the populations
which have the greatest needs and are difficult to serve; promotes
coordination between service providers; and provides informational
educational activities and products for providers and consumers
in Erie County. The programs operated by the Buffalo Prenatal-Perinatal
Network to address these issues are described in the pages of
